The Southern Association
of Tea Businesses,
Inc. was established
in 1998 as a non-profit
professional organization
for people involved
in the world of tea. Since our inception, we have been a force in the tea industry. Each member is unique in their participation, yet all share the same goal or working together to achieve extraordinary success.
Although our memberships spans across nine states, we still maintain the warmth and camaraderie that is so much a part of our character.
Mission Statement:
- Provide a forum
where owners and
mangers of tea businesses
can discuss issues
and provide mutual
support.
- Be a force in
the tea industry
setting the standard
for ethical business
practice.
- Educate the public
on the joys of taking
tea.
